Unveiling the Mystery of Divination

Divination, in its essence, is the practice of seeking knowledge of the future or the unknown by supernatural means. Historically, it’s an ancient art, used across cultures and eras, serving as a bridge between the earthly realm and the divine.

While Biblical scripture often advises caution against relying solely on human methods or unknown spirits for guidance, it emphasizes the importance of seeking wisdom and discernment. Proverbs 3:5-6 encourages us: "Trust in the Lord with all your heart and lean not on your own understanding; in all your ways submit to Him, and He will make your paths straight." This beautiful passage beckons us to seek divine guidance earnestly, reminding us that ultimate clarity and direction stem from our connection with God.

The Magic of Oracle Cards

Oracle cards are a modern embodiment of divination practices, often used to gain insight, clarity, and inspiration. They serve as a tool for reflection and meditation, helping us to access our intuition and inner wisdom. Each card holds a unique message or theme, inviting us to ponder and explore aspects of our lives that require attention or healing.

When used with intention and reverence, oracle cards can enhance our spiritual journey by echoing the wisdom of God present within us. Just like parables and teachings in the Bible, these cards can prompt us to think deeply about our lives and the values we aspire to embody. They encourage reflection and prayer, aligning our focus on qualities such as love, compassion, forgiveness, and hope—all core tenets found in the teachings of Jesus.

Q1: What are divination and oracle cards?

A1: Divination and oracle cards are tools used for gaining insight, guidance, and clarity on various aspects of life. They serve as a means to access one’s intuition and often involve seeking answers from a higher power or the subconscious mind. While similar to tarot cards, oracle cards can vary widely in terms of themes, imagery, and messages.


Q2: How do oracle cards differ from tarot cards?

A2: Oracle cards differ from tarot cards in structure and use. Tarot decks typically consist of 78 cards with a set structure, including the Major and Minor Arcana, whereas oracle decks can have any number of cards and are not bound by a specific structure. Oracle decks often focus on themes, such as angels, animals, or specific spiritual teachings and provide more open-ended guidance.


Q3: What is the purpose of using oracle cards in divination?

A3: The purpose of using oracle cards is to receive guidance, support, and clarity on personal questions or situations. They act as a tool for self-reflection and can help one connect with their inner wisdom, explore emotions, and make informed decisions. Each card typically offers messages and advice which can be interpreted intuitively by the reader.


Q4: Can anyone use oracle cards, or do you need special abilities?

A4: Anyone can use oracle cards; no special abilities are required. What is important is an open mind and a willingness to trust one’s intuition. The process involves shuffling the deck while focusing on a question, drawing cards, and interpreting their meanings based on the imagery and messages provided by the deck.


Q5: How should a beginner approach learning to read oracle cards?

A5: A beginner should start by familiarizing themselves with their chosen deck. This can involve looking at each card, reading the guidebook, and noticing what impressions and thoughts arise. Practicing regularly and keeping a journal of readings can help you connect with and understand the messages better. Trust your intuition and be patient with the learning process.


Q6: Are there any common spreads used in oracle card readings?

A6: Yes, there are several common spreads used in oracle card readings, though they can be more flexible than tarot card spreads due to the varying nature of oracle decks. Common spreads include the single-card draw for daily guidance, the three-card spread for past, present, and future insights, and more complex spreads for deeper exploration of specific topics.


Q7: How do I choose an oracle deck that is right for me?

A7: Choosing an oracle deck is a personal decision and should resonate with you on a spiritual or aesthetic level. Consider the artwork, theme, and the type of messages you prefer. You might also read reviews or explore sample cards to see if the deck aligns with your intuition and current needs.


Q8: Can oracle cards predict the future?

A8: Oracle cards are not typically used for predicting the future in definitive terms. Instead, they provide guidance, insight, and potential outcomes based on current energies and circumstances. They are meant to empower and help individuals make informed decisions rather than serve as a fortune-telling tool.
